Burrill publishes a wide range of biotechnology/life science bio-intelligence reports, the Journal of Life Sciences and facilitates leading life sciences conferences and events. The company analyzes the state-of-the-industry through its monthly reports, the quarterly Burrill Biotechnology Intelligence Report and its flagship annual book -- the 22nd Edition entitled Biotech 2008: A Vision for the Next Decade will be published in January 2008.
